Biography

Jan Smit (born 31 December 1985) is a Dutch singer, television host, and actor. Smit mostly sings songs in the Dutch language, in a genre known as palingsound. In addition to his solo career, in 2015 Smit joined the schlager trio Klubbb3, and in 2017 the Toppers. As a TV presenter, he has worked on programs like the Beste Zangers (Best Singers in the Netherlands) and Sterren Muziekfeest op het Plein (Music Festival on the square.) Since 1999, Smit has been serving as an ambassador for the SOS Children's Villages.
